Job description

  • Report Generation: Perform all necessary collection of requirements, design, development, testing, and delivery for customer reports.
  • Data Analytics & Delivery: Understand, develop, and deliver intuitive, high-quality reports that meet specific requirements requested by clientele through our customer experience team.
  • Requirement Gathering: Actively collaborate with internal teams to clarify customer data and report requests, ensuring accurate data delivery and optimal report structuring.
  • Software Development (Scripting & Tooling): Support and develop internal tooling and scripts to automate the development, testing, and deployment of custom client reports.
  • Troubleshooting: Investigate, root-cause, and resolve reporting errors or missing data.

Requirements

Do you have experience in Tooling?, Do you have a Bachelor’s degree in statistics?, * Experience: 2-4 years of experience in data analytics, reporting, or a heavily data-driven role.

  • Technical Skills:
  • Proficiency in SQL and MSSQL (Core)
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ft SSRS
  • Experience with scripting languages for automation (Python, R, or PowerShell)
  • Familiarity with C# and programmatic document/PDF generation is a strong plus
  • Advanced proficiency in Excel and general report generation
  • Core Competencies:
  • Analytical Mindset: Strong critical thinking and strategic problem-solving skills.
  • Data Management: Exceptional attention to detail when collecting, organizing, and analyzing large datasets.
  • Execution: Ability to follow established security/data procedures while successfully prioritizing competing tasks., * Industry experience in the recreational vehicle, motorcycle, heavy equipment, and/or commercial truck sectors.
  • Education: Bachelor’s Degree in a quantitative field (Mathematics, Economics, Computer Science, Information Management, or Statistics).
